Program offers research-based method for weight management
DAVENPORT, Iowa - Profile by Sanford is now open at 3010 E. 53rd Street in Davenport. This is the second store Iowa. The Hawkeye state's first Profile store is in Clive and opened in July.
Profile launched in Sioux Falls, South Dakota, opening its first store front in November 2012. Today, it has 16 locations in five states with several more planned openings by the end of 2014.
Profile was designed using a large body of clinical research to ensure a sustainable means to healthy weight loss. A clinical and scientific advisory board comprised of Sanford Health physicians and researchers oversaw the development of the Profile system. Sanford Health is the largest, rural, not-for-profit health care system in the United States.
"This state-of-the-art weight-loss system has brought clinically-proven results to communities across the Dakotas, Minnesota and Nebraska," said local store manager Justin Roberson. "I'm eager to see the results this nutritional program will have here in Davenport."
The rapidly growing Profile system utilizes meal-replacement products, nutritionally complete food and qualified health coaches. In addition to members consuming both Profile-produced and grocery-store food, coaches develop customized plans for their clients and offer advice on nutrition, exercise and behavior.
Profile continues to focus on program advancements through the launch of new food products, such as three new pizza varieties available this fall. Profile is also on the cutting edge of technology, expanding to better assist members with measuring daily activity. A new fitness tracker will provide additional measurable data that will be helpful to members and coaches in helping to monitor progress toward goals.
In addition to face-to-face meetings, coaches are able to efficiently track members' progress through the use of smart wireless technology. Each member is outfitted with wireless devices to measure progress, including tools to track body weight, measurement and blood pressure. These devices automatically upload to a secure server, where members and coaches can monitor improvement on the web or mobile applications. Printed options are also available to members.

About Sanford Health
Sanford Health is an integrated health system headquartered in the Dakotas and is now the largest, rural, not-for-profit health care system in the nation with locations in 126 communities in nine states. In addition, Sanford Health is in the process of developing international clinics in Ghana, Mexico and China.
Sanford Health includes 43 hospitals, 140 clinic locations and 1,360 physicians in 81 specialty areas of medicine. With more than 26,000 employees, Sanford Health is the largest employer in North Dakota and South Dakota. The system is experiencing dynamic growth and development in conjunction with nearly $1 billion in gifts from philanthropist Denny Sanford. These gifts are making possible the implementation of several initiatives, including global children's clinics, multiple research centers and finding cures for type 1 diabetes and breast cancer.
